Tom Watt

    Tom Watt is an English author with a distinct focus on the world of football. His writing excels in its insightful look into the sport's inner workings, often employing extensive interviews to craft compelling narratives. Watt's approach blends a deep understanding of the game with a narrative flair, offering readers an authentic and detailed perspective on football culture. His works explore not just the sport itself, but the people and places that shape it.

      Come with us on a journey through time to discover the moments that made football. Each chapter in this book is about a match that helped make football popular - from the first FA Cup final in 1872, to England's Lionesses winning the European final in 2022! Football is the world's most popular game. When people who love football aren't actually playing, they're often watching games and talking about it! Maybe once you've read The Big Match, you might want to share your own football stories. After all, everybody is a part of the game! The Big Match: Moments That Made Football is part of the Reading Planet Cosmos range of books from Hodder Education. Cosmos provides a vibrant collection of fiction and non-fiction books that will widen children's reading horizons. Reading Planet books have been carefully levelled to support children in becoming fluent and confident readers. Each book features useful notes and questions to support reading at home and develop comprehension skills. Reading age: 8-9 years.
